There is no globally recognized certification titled "Certified Professional in Cosmic Ray Neutron Shielding Developments." The field of cosmic ray neutron shielding is highly specialized, typically requiring advanced degrees in physics, engineering, or a related field. Professional development in this area comes through experience and participation in relevant research projects or collaborations with organizations focusing on radiation protection and space exploration.
Learning outcomes for individuals seeking expertise in this niche would involve a deep understanding of cosmic ray physics, neutron interactions with matter, shielding design principles (including Monte Carlo simulations and radiation transport codes), and materials science related to radiation resistance. They would also develop skills in risk assessment, regulatory compliance (related to radiation safety), and data analysis pertaining to neutron flux and dose calculations. These skills are crucial for successful cosmic ray neutron shielding developments.
The duration of acquiring this expertise is highly variable. It can range from several years of postgraduate study and research to a decade or more of practical experience in industry. The specific path depends on the individual's background and chosen career trajectory. Formal coursework might involve master's or doctoral programs in nuclear engineering, radiation physics, or astrophysics, supplemented by specialized training.
Industry relevance for professionals with expertise in cosmic ray neutron shielding is significant, particularly in space exploration, high-altitude aviation, and possibly even in the design of large-scale underground facilities. The ability to mitigate the effects of cosmic radiation on sensitive equipment and human health is paramount in these contexts. Demand for experts in this field is likely to grow alongside future space exploration initiatives and advancements in high-energy physics research. This expertise ensures the safety of astronauts and the proper functioning of space-based technology.
